Files
sova-deploy/argocd/apps/test-contour.yaml
T
2026-05-28 12:06:15 +03:00

145 lines
2.9 KiB
YAML

apiVersion: argoproj.io/v1alpha1
kind: Application
metadata:
name: data-test
namespace: argocd
spec:
project: sova
source:
repoURL: ${GITEA_REPO_URL}/sova/sova-deploy.git
targetRevision: main
path: data/test
helm:
valueFiles:
- values.yaml
destination:
server: https://kubernetes.default.svc
namespace: sova-data-test
syncPolicy:
automated:
prune: true
selfHeal: true
syncOptions:
- CreateNamespace=true
---
apiVersion: argoproj.io/v1alpha1
kind: Application
metadata:
name: mocks-test
namespace: argocd
spec:
project: sova
source:
repoURL: ${GITEA_REPO_URL}/sova/sova-mocks.git
targetRevision: main
path: charts/mocks
destination:
server: https://kubernetes.default.svc
namespace: sova-mocks
syncPolicy:
automated:
prune: true
selfHeal: true
syncOptions:
- CreateNamespace=true
---
apiVersion: argoproj.io/v1alpha1
kind: Application
metadata:
name: backend-test
namespace: argocd
spec:
project: sova
source:
repoURL: ${GITEA_REPO_URL}/sova/sova-deploy.git
targetRevision: main
path: apps/backend
helm:
valueFiles:
- values.yaml
- values-test.yaml
destination:
server: https://kubernetes.default.svc
namespace: sova-test
syncPolicy:
automated:
prune: true
selfHeal: true
syncOptions:
- CreateNamespace=true
---
apiVersion: argoproj.io/v1alpha1
kind: Application
metadata:
name: adminpanel-test
namespace: argocd
spec:
project: sova
source:
repoURL: ${GITEA_REPO_URL}/sova/sova-deploy.git
targetRevision: main
path: apps/adminpanel
helm:
valueFiles:
- values.yaml
- values-test.yaml
destination:
server: https://kubernetes.default.svc
namespace: sova-test
syncPolicy:
automated:
prune: true
selfHeal: true
syncOptions:
- CreateNamespace=true
---
apiVersion: argoproj.io/v1alpha1
kind: Application
metadata:
name: docs-test
namespace: argocd
spec:
project: sova
source:
repoURL: ${GITEA_REPO_URL}/sova/sova-deploy.git
targetRevision: main
path: apps/docs
helm:
valueFiles:
- values.yaml
- values-test.yaml
destination:
server: https://kubernetes.default.svc
namespace: sova-test
syncPolicy:
automated:
prune: true
selfHeal: true
syncOptions:
- CreateNamespace=true
---
apiVersion: argoproj.io/v1alpha1
kind: Application
metadata:
name: cabinet-test
namespace: argocd
spec:
project: sova
source:
repoURL: ${GITEA_REPO_URL}/sova/sova-deploy.git
targetRevision: main
path: apps/cabinet
helm:
valueFiles:
- values.yaml
- values-test.yaml
destination:
server: https://kubernetes.default.svc
namespace: sova-test
syncPolicy:
automated:
prune: true
selfHeal: true
syncOptions:
- CreateNamespace=true